WebNov 12, 2024 · Who Is Esther Perel? Esther Perel is a licensed and practicing psychotherapist. She’s best known for counseling couples on a variety of topics and issues, often helping them to reflect on themselves through the lens of their childhood and the trauma they’ve had in life. WebAug 16, 2024 · Esther Perel. Esther Perel is a psychotherapist and New York Times bestselling author who is an expert on modern relationships. A child of Holocaust survivors who is fluent in nine languages, she has been in private practice in NYC for more than 35 years and works as an organizational consultant for Fortune 500 companies globally.
